We celebrate Christmas in December.
Here in Portugal it is celebrated on the night of the 24th – Christmas Eve. Usually, the family gets together for dinner at 9p.m. We can have many traditional dishes – codfish and potatoes, boiled octopus and some roasted meat. Afterwards, we eat lots of desserts such as bread golden slices, custard cream, “aletria”, “sonhos” and a lot of other sweets .
Slide 7:
At midnight, we swap presents and Father Christmas leaves presents for the children. We stay up all night, talking, playing with our presents and having fun till late. On the 25th, we all have breakfast as a family and then at 12.30 p.m. we start preparing lunch, which consists mainly of the leftovers from the night before and maybe some more roasted meat. We spend the afternoon laughing, singing and dancing, eating lots of food and chocolates right into the evening.
Family reunion goes on!
